MINNEAPOLIS (AP) - Police say a 10-year-old boy’s leg was severed as he played on a moving train in north Minneapolis.
The accident happened Saturday afternoon at train tracks near Webber Park. Police say three boys, including the victim, were hopping on and off a slow-moving train.
Officers used a tourniquet to stop the boy’s bleeding. WCCO-TV (https://cbsloc.al/1S1yYUM ) reports he was taken to North Memorial Medical Center in Robbinsdale, and is expected to survive.
